Matsmart-Motatos is a different kind of food store, challenging the thought of sustainable consumption. We’re a European grocery e-commerce, aiding the sustainable reform of our food system by giving everyone a chance to save our planet in an effortless way. We partner with food and FMCG companies to save products at risk of going to waste by re-selling them at discounted prices directly to consumers: sustainable, affordable and accessible to all.

Today, our shops are open in Sweden, Finland, Denmark, Germany and Austria. Working at Matsmart-Motatos, you will join our fight against food waste and contribute to making the world a better place.

Responsibilities

  • Architect, provision, configure, and operate Snowflake infrastructure on Azure (warehouses, databases, schemas, roles, permissions, external stages) using Terraform or equivalent IaC.

  • Manage associated Azure cloud infrastructure required by the data platform: storage (e.g. Blob / Data Lake Gen2), networking, identity & access (Azure Entra ID, managed identities), secret management, virtual networks, etc.

  • If needed, support occasional Google Cloud components: e.g. storage buckets or services, IAM / permissions in GCP, etc.

  • Build, maintain, and enhance CI/CD pipelines / workflows for infrastructure (say Terraform on Azure) and data assets (schemas, warehouse changes, roles, permissions).

  • Embed security & governance: RBAC, least privilege, audit logging, compliance, secrets management. Use Azure’s tools (Key Vault, Azure AD roles) to secure credentials and access.

  • Monitor & optimize performance and cost for Snowflake usage on Azure: warehouse sizing, auto-suspend / scale, query performance, usage patterns; also watch Azure costs for storage / networking / compute.

  • Setup observability & alerting: logs, metrics, query latency, failures; detect drift in infrastructure or configuration. Use Azure monitoring tools, Snowflake’s built-in metrics, etc.

  • Work with data engineering / analytics folks to support ingestion pipelines, schema evolution, transformations; ensure dev/test/prod environments aligned and reproducible.

  • Document architecture, standards, deployment / rollback procedures, best practices; ensure recoverability, fault tolerance, and environment parity.

Required Qualifications

  • 3-5+ years (or more, depending on seniority) in data platform or infrastructure engineering.

  • Strong experience with Snowflake, in particular on Azure: designing schemas, warehouses, roles/permissions, external stages, performance tuning.

  • Proven experience with Terraform (or comparable IaC) to manage Snowflake and Azure resources.

  • Deep knowledge of Azure services relevant for data infrastructure: Azure Blob / Data Lake, Azure Entra ID, Key Vault (secrets), networking (VNets), permissions; familiarity with Google Cloud is a plus.

  • Strong SQL skills; experience optimizing queries, performance tuning, working with semi-structured data.

  • Good Python skills

  • Experience designing and operating CI/CD pipelines (Terraform + Snowflake + Azure).

  • Being familiar with Docker and containerized solutions

  • Solid security mindset: access control, encryption, auditing, least privilege, secret management.

  • Ability to make trade-offs between cost, performance, complexity; experience with cost monitoring / cost management in Azure & Snowflake.

  • Experience working end-to-end: from raw data ingestion to clean, transformed, modeled data for dashboards, ML, operational use.

  • Good communication; can work across teams (Cloud / DevOps / Security / Data Engineering).

About Matsmart-Motatos

Matsmart-Motatos is an e-commerce and impact company that saves already-produced food and consumer products from going to waste. How? Simply by buying surplus from FMCG suppliers and selling it cheap online to cost- and climate-conscious consumers in Sweden, Finland, Denmark, Germany, and Austria. A double win for the planet as well as people’s wallets.
